Package: apcupsd
Version: 3.14.12-1.1
Severity: normal

Dear Maintainer,

*** Reporter, please consider answering these questions, where appropriate ***

   * What led up to the situation?
   Run apcaccess
   * What exactly did you do (or not do) that was effective (or
     ineffective)?
   Run apcaccess

   * What was the outcome of this action?
   Error contacting apcupsd @ :3551: No such process

   * What outcome did you expect instead?
   For it to print the output, or at least tell me what to fix


apctest ran fine, as did service apcupsd start.  The daemon is running and
I can telnet to port 3551.  This is all I see in apcupsd.events:

2015-06-22 08:14:52 -0400  apcupsd 3.14.12 (29 March 2014) debian startup 
succeeded

What's wrong?
What does the message mean?
